Henry John Schumacher 1887 – 1924 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 8 January 1887

Birth Location: Jackson County, Iowa

Death Date: 29 January 1924

Death Location: Grafton, Walsh, North Dakota, USA

Father: Otto Schumacher

Mother: Marie Meyer

Spouse(s): Anna Wagner

Children(s): Raymond Schumacher

The story of Henry John Schumacher began in 1887 in Jackson County, Iowa. In 1900, Henry John Schumacher resided in Acton Twp, Walsh County, North Dakota, USA. Henry John Schumacher married Anna Lydia Wagner, and had children including Raymond Charles Schumacher. Henry John Schumacher passed away in 1924 in Grafton, Walsh, North Dakota, USA.
